Roundwood, non-coniferous β Production in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
Saint Vincent and the Grenadines: Roundwood, non-coniferous β Production was 6,901 m3 in 2024. βΌ Falling
Roundwood, non-coniferous β Production in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ines, 1961β2024
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in m3.
Analysis
The most recent figure for roundwood, non-coniferous β production in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ines is 6,901 m3, measured in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 64 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.5% on the previous year and down 4.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, roundwood, non-coniferous β production in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ines peaked at 12,164 m3 in 1961 and was at its lowest, 6,901 m3, in 2024.
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ranks 173rd of 197 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 64 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 11,872 m3 | 11,583 m3 | 12,164 m3 | 9 |
| 1970s | 11,380 m3 | 10,974 m3 | 11,755 m3 | 10 |
| 1980s | 10,097 m3 | 9,364 m3 | 10,829 m3 | 10 |
| 1990s | 8,704 m3 | 8,328 m3 | 9,232 m3 | 10 |
| 2000s | 7,822 m3 | 7,502 m3 | 8,217 m3 | 10 |
| 2010s | 7,245 m3 | 7,071 m3 | 7,444 m3 | 10 |
| 2020s | 6,969 m3 | 6,901 m3 | 7,037 m3 | 5 |

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
